Friday, September 19, 0730 GMT
Top stories
The Times: The Financial Services Authority banned short selling of shares in all British financial companies until January 16.
New York Times: The US Government is considering buying distressed mortgages at deep discounts in the biggest ever financial bailout; it saw markets lift 4 per cent.
Reuters: The US Federal Reserve pumped $105 billion (£58 billion) into US markets on top of a $180 billion (£100 billion) rescue plan by the world's major central banks.
Comment
David Wighton in The Times: Barclays and Lloyds TSB's credit-crunch purchases could pay handsomely, but they increase the risk profile for both banks.
Damian Reece in the Daily Telegraph: To help capitalism recover, the FSA should help the walking wounded into the arms of the healthy, not restrict it.
Lex in the Financial Times: Regulators have banned it for financial stocks, but short-sellers were already squeezing themselves into losing positions.
Upside
The Times: Barclays will raise £1.3 billion ($2.3 billion) in a share issue and from existing investors to help pay for Lehman Brothers' US investment banking unit.
New York Times: Quarterly profit at Oracle, the world's second largest software maker, rose 28 per cent to $1.1 billion (£609 million), beating expectations.
